(±)-Stylopine (Tetrahydrocoptisine) is an alkaloid compound. (±)-Stylopine can be isolated from the tubers of the plant Corydalis. (±)-Stylopine inhibits TNF-α, IL-6, and NO production, and attenuates phosphorylation of p38 MAPK, ERK1/2. (±)-Stylopine inhibits NF-κB expression. (±)-Stylopine exhibits anti-inflammatory activity. (±)-Stylopine has protective effects against foot edema, gastric ulcers, anxiety, depression, and acute lung injury[1][2][3][4].
In Vitro:(±)-Stylopine (10-4 -1 μg/mL; 24 h pretreatment before 12 h LPS stimulation) significantly inhibits LPS-induced TNF-α, IL-6 production[1].
In Vivo:(±)-Stylopine (7-21 mg/kg; i.p.; 30 min before modeling) inhibits Carrageenan (HY-125474)-induced rat paw edema and reduces TNF-α, IL-6 levels in paw tissue[1].
(±)-Stylopine (10-20 mg/kg; i.p.; 3 days) attenuates ethanol-induced gastric ulcer in mice, reduces NO, TNF-α, IL-6 levels, MPO activity and NF-κB expression in gastric tissue and serum[2].
(±)-Stylopine (18.4-36.8 mg/kg; i.p.; 14 days) alleviates LPS-induced neuroinflammation in mice, improves anxiety, depression and anhedonia, reduces neurodegeneration, inhibits KMO expression, NO and lipid peroxidation[3].
(±)-Stylopine (10-20 mg/kg; i.p.; 30 min before LPS injection) reduces mortality, ameliorates lung injury, inhibits inflammatory cell infiltration, protein leakage, TNF-α, IL-6 production and NF-κB activation in LPS-induced acute lung injury in rats[4].
